ms — meta_skill search/load engine

> Core Insight: ms is the skill-search engine over both configured corpora (agentops + jsm). Consume via MCP, write/admin via CLI. One law: after ANY reindex/wipe, every running ms mcp serve MUST be killed (sessions respawn fresh). A surviving server silently reads pre-wipe data and returns recorded:true on writes that land in orphaned files.

Constraints

  • Load with full: true or --full when the intent is to execute a skill, because metadata cards and packed overviews omit runnable guidance.
  • Keep the consume/write boundary explicit: use MCP for search and load, but use the CLI for feedback and outcomes because only CLI writes are verified to land in the live database.
  • When attached mcp__ms__* tools are unavailable, use the skill-local one-shot MCP helper for search. A zero-result ms search CLI response is not evidence that MCP BM25 found no match and must not silently substitute for it.
  • Reindex only through scripts/ms-reindex.sh, because it sweeps stale servers and proves source equivalence after rebuilding the index.
  • Treat the local index as disposable state, not a source of truth; the non-goal is editing indexed content instead of skills/**.
  • Keep ms retrieval-only for production skill work. It returns search and load

results; the caller owns authoring, validation, and every subsequent decision.

Quick Start

Find a skill (MCP-primary — BM25, currently strictly better than CLI search), then load the FULL runnable SKILL.md in one call (always full: true when you mean to use it):

mcp__ms__search {query: "handle a rate limit switching accounts"}
mcp__ms__load {skill: "account-rotation", full: true}

No attached MCP tool: start one disposable stdio server, return only the structured search JSON, and reap it on success, error, or timeout:

python3 skills/ms/scripts/mcp-search.py "switch accounts on rate limit"
ms load account-rotation --full -O json | jq -r '.data.content'

State root: ~/Library/Application Support/ms/.


Consume — MCP-primary (mcp__ms__*)

Prefer the MCP tools whenever a ms mcp serve is attached — they are the fast, verified read path.

| Tool | Use |

|------|-----|

| mcp__ms__search {query} | BM25 search. Currently strictly better than CLI search (see Footguns — CLI hybrid is BM25-only; ms never stores doc embeddings). |

| mcp__ms__load {skill, full: true} | Returns the full runnable SKILL.md in ONE call, zero extraction friction. full: false returns a useless metadata card — always full: true when you intend to use the skill. |

| mcp__ms__show {skill} | Metadata card for a skill. |

| mcp__ms__suggest {cwd} | Suggests skills for a directory. Works — but ignore its project-language detection (misdetects Makefile repos as C; cosmetic only). |

No attached MCP tool: use the server-backed one-shot helper so retrieval still follows the MCP BM25 path:

python3 skills/ms/scripts/mcp-search.py "<query>"

The helper writes a clean search object (query, count, results) to stdout, reports transport/protocol errors on stderr, applies a 30-second timeout by default, and owns the disposable server process group through termination and reap. Override its executable with MS_BIN and its timeout with MS_MCP_SEARCH_TIMEOUT or --timeout.

The CLI remains the supported full-load fallback after search:

ms load <id> --full -O json | jq -r '.data.content'   # content lives in .data.content

Do not replace the helper with ms search. The CLI path is useful only for diagnostics while its retrieval parity gap remains; in particular, zero CLI results do not prove the corpus has no matching skill.


Write / Admin — CLI-only (verified landing in the live DB)

The MCP feedback tool exists, but only the CLI write path is verified to land — trust the CLI for writes.

ms feedback add <skill> --positive --comment "..."   # feedback on a skill
ms feedback add <skill> --negative --comment "..."

ms outcome <skill> --success   # record only AFTER downstream factory use + validation
ms outcome <skill> --failure

ms doctor                      # admin: health
scripts/ms-reindex.sh          # (re)index THE way: rebuild + sweep + probe + source-equivalence check
scripts/ms-reindex.sh --check-source  # read-only freshness proof against current skills/** source
# Optional operator policy only; rebuild completeness is derived from live
# discovered/indexed/errors accounting, not a historical absolute count:
MS_REINDEX_MIN_INDEXED=100 scripts/ms-reindex.sh
ms list -O jsonl --limit 1000  # counting / enumeration
ms config                      # resolved config + skill_paths

Output Specification

  • Path: search, load, and admin results are returned on stdout; durable index state remains under ~/Library/Application Support/ms/.
  • Filename: no result filename is created by this skill; callers capture CLI output explicitly when they need a durable artifact.
  • Format: attached MCP returns structured tool data; the one-shot helper unwraps MCP content into clean search JSON; CLI automation uses JSON or JSONL, with full skill text at .data.content for ms load --full -O json.
  • Validation command: run skills/ms/scripts/validate.sh for the retrieval boundary and scripts/ms-reindex.sh --check-source for normalized source equivalence.
  • Downstream handoff: return the loaded guidance and source identity to the caller. Retrieval never chooses or starts a workflow.

Production Skill Handoff

Production-intent handoff: When the query concerns creating or editing a skill, ms retrieves relevant guidance and stops. The caller may separately invoke skill-builder (create, heal, or audit mode) or another authoring tool.

Authority boundary: skills/** is canonical source; the generator owns the ms Codex twin and other projections. Never edit the index, loaded copies, or generated projections as source.

ms never validates or interprets downstream work. A failed search,

load, write, or reindex is returned as evidence and ends this invocation.

Outcome timing: Record ms outcome only after the caller has independent evidence about downstream usefulness, never after retrieval alone. That observation does not change core state.


Footguns (measured through 2026-07-15)

| Footgun | Truth |

|---|---|

| MCP server survives a DB wipe/reindex | An ms mcp serve NEVER reopens handles — it follows renamed inodes into the backup, giving stale reads AND silent misdirected writes (recorded:true into orphaned files). Reindex via scripts/ms-reindex.sh — THE way to reindex (rebuilds, proves every live-discovered skill was indexed or reported as an allowed error, TERMs every server, probes a fresh server, then compares normalized local loads with current skills/** source); never run bare ms index and leave servers up. Sessions respawn fresh. |

| ms load --pack N | Trap: caps at the gutted overview tier for ANY N (800 == 20000) — drops the executable steps and returns LESS than the no-flag default. Use --full (CLI) or full: true (MCP). |

| -O plain | Prints name-only on load; truncates list output ([N more lines]). The content lives in -O json.data.content. |

| CLI ms search "hybrid" | Effectively BM25-only — ms never stores doc embeddings (upsert_embedding is called only from a unit test), so hybrid ≡ BM25 under ANY backend; no config/backend change fixes it (upstream gap, feature-noted; measured 2026-07-02, age-s3jf). It can return zero while MCP BM25 returns ranked matches. Without attached tools, use scripts/mcp-search.py; never treat zero CLI results as a successful MCP fallback. |

| Stale ms.lock | ms doctor prints "Lock held" for a DEAD pid yet still says all-pass. A dead-pid lock is safe to delete. |

| Symlinks | ms does NOT follow directory symlinks — skill_paths must list BOTH roots explicitly: the ~/.claude skills dir AND the ~/dev/agentops/skills repo dir. |

| Binary | Source build only (~/dev/meta_skill, branch local/frontmatter-id); the 0.1.2 release binary corrupts IDs on Anthropic-frontmatter skills. Update: git fetch && git rebase origin/main && cargo install --path . --locked. |

Concurrency

Parallel CLI + MCP load measured clean — no lock errors. The lock hazard is the survive-a-wipe case above (kill the serve), not concurrent reads.


Scenarios

Scenario: Load a skill's full runnable guidance
  Given an ms mcp serve is attached
  When I call mcp__ms__load {skill: "account-rotation", full: true}
  Then the full runnable SKILL.md content is returned in one call

Scenario: Search without an attached MCP tool
  Given mcp__ms__search is unavailable
  When I run python3 skills/ms/scripts/mcp-search.py with the query
  Then it returns only structured MCP search JSON
  And its disposable ms mcp serve process is reaped on success, error, or timeout

Scenario: Reindex invalidates every running server
  Given one or more ms mcp serve processes are running
  When I run ms index (or wipe/rebuild the DB)
  Then I kill every ms mcp serve so sessions respawn against fresh data
  And a surviving server would silently read pre-wipe data and mis-land writes

Scenario: A stale local projection fails closed
  Given AgentOps skills are authoritative and ms is a disposable local index
  When a full ms load has a different normalized name or description from source
  Then scripts/ms-reindex.sh exits nonzero and names the stale skill

Quality Checklist

  • Full loads preserve the complete runnable guidance rather than a metadata card or packed overview.
  • Search reads use attached MCP tools or the one-shot MCP helper, never a silent zero-result CLI substitution; full loads use MCP or the verified CLI shape.
  • Any rebuild accounts for every live-discovered skill, rejects an empty searchable index, then finishes with stale servers swept and source equivalence reported.
  • Production skill intent leaves ms after retrieval; generated twins and loaded/indexed copies are never hand-edited as source.
  • Search and load results remain advisory inputs, never proof that downstream work is correct.
  • ms outcome records observed usefulness only after independent downstream evidence.

How to use it

Copy the folder

Take boshu2/ms from the repository into ~/.claude/skills for personal use, or into .claude/skills inside a project.

Check the name does not clash

The agent identifies a skill by the name field in its header. Two skills with the same name cannot sit side by side — one of them will be ignored.

Install what it needs

The instructions reference cargo, go. Without those the skill loads but fails at the first command.
